While Stansbury's victory against Cottonwood wasn't quite the blowout it was the last time the pair played, they still came out on top. The Stallions won by a set and slipped past the Colts 3-2. The Stallions haven't had any issues with the Colts recently, as the game was their ninth consecutive win against them.
Stansbury found their leader in sophomore Mckaslyn Major, who had 13 digs and one assist.
Stansbury was lethal from the service line and finished the game with 12 aces.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now served at least five aces in four consecutive matchups.
Stansbury's victory bumped their record up to 5-12. As for Cottonwood, they are on a seven-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 3-13.
Stansbury has already played their next contest, a 3-1 win against Delta on the 20th. As for Cottonwood, they also wasted no time getting back out on the court and have already played their next game, a 3-0 defeat against Dixie on the 20th.
